Output 938c34a88e10981337bcd8255fbe0185242e30493607d7c46b20d21608509ab7:3

value
388850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68f7d44b560d6053f84bcf60932bb47e7af89656 OP_EQUALVERIFY OP_CHECKSIG
address
1Aa2ARxKGdaVZ4AfPwuPKi3r5g625o7o6G
transaction
938c34a88e10981337bcd8255fbe0185242e30493607d7c46b20d21608509ab7
spent
true